Senior Analog-/Mixed-Signal Design Engineer(m/w/x)
Designing and simulating opamps, ADCs, DACs, and memory blocks for edge AI hardware. Advanced analog design theory and low-power circuit design focus required. 30 vacation days, virtual stock options.

Tasks
- Design and validate analog and mixed-signal integrated circuits
- Simulate opamps, low-power circuits, ADCs, DACs, logic, and memory blocks
- Lead schematic design and simulation
- Perform layout and parasitic extraction
- Conduct post-layout simulations for design verification
- Integrate and sign off top-level designs
- Emphasize low-power performance and noise robustness
- Ensure proper physical design implementation
- Handle board-level design and integration
- Test and debug silicon prototypes in the lab
- Optimize performance and resolve issues
- Collaborate with teams to meet system-level requirements
- Maintain technical documentation for design, testing, and verification

About the Company
GEMESYS GmbH
Industry
IT
Description
GEMESYS is a deep-tech startup focused on designing a chip that works like the human brain to overcome computing bottlenecks. They aim to shape a better future for everyone through next-generation AI hardware.
